    For the last few days the glow plug "idiot light" has been coming on and off when driving my 1.9TDI. Went past Kwikfit as they recently serviced my car but as my car still starts and runs fine (and their diagnostic tools were down) they recommended me going past the stealers to run a diagnostic at the estimated cost of £50... This morning I have been reading up on the more technical part of the glow plug and can understand a faulty glow plug could cause serious troubles in the short term but as my light has been going on and off I am wondering whether it isn't merely a faulty sensor.

    Has anyone else have this light come on and realistically - would you advise against driving further till sorted?     Glowplug light will flash if you have a brake light out, or a faulty brake pedal switch.
